Freedom of Information

The Freedom of Information (Scotland) Act 2002 (the Act) requires that all public authorities in Scotland must produce and maintain a publication scheme. This must detail all of the key information that we publish and how you can access it. Argyll Community Housing Association was designed (with other Registered Social Landlords) as a public authority with effect from 11th November 2019.

Argyll Community Housing Association (ACHA) has adopted the Scottish Information Commissioner's (SIC) Model Publication Scheme (MPS) 2018. This scheme highlights the information that is published and has been made available through our website.

Argyll Community Housing Association are entitled to charge for providing information. However, as a good will gesture, we have decided to not charge at this time for any Freedom of Information enquires.

You have a legal right to access information, and a right of appeal to the Scottish Information Commissioner if you are dissatisfied with our response. There rights will only apply to requests made in writing or another recordable format. If you are unhappy with our responses to your request you can ask us to review it, and if you are still unhappy, you can make an appeal to the Scottish Information Commissioner.
